Turkic Council education ministers meet in Istanbul for 6th meeting

Officials get together ahead of 8th Turkic Council summit, when Turkey will take over term presidency

2021-11-03 12:49:04

ANKARA

The sixth meeting of education ministers of Turkic Council's member states, and the fourth gathering of International Turkic Academy will be held in Istanbul on Wednesday and Thursday, respectively.

The education-themed gatherings will first be attended by senior state officials, and the ministers will exchange views the next day.

Besides the ministers, Turkic Council Secretary-General Baghdad Amreyev, International Turkic Academy head Darkhan Kydyrali and Hungarian Consul General Laszlo Keller are also expected to participate.

Turkish Education Minister Mahmut Ozer will moderate the events, and also hold bilateral talks with his counterparts.

According to Turkey's National Education Ministry, the 8th Turkic Council summit is scheduled to be held in Istanbul on Nov. 12, and will be hosted by President Recep Tayyip Erdogan. Turkey will take over the term presidency at the event.

The Turkic Council was formed in 2009 to promote cooperation among Turkic speaking states. It consists of Azerbaijan, Kazakhstan, Kyrgyzstan, Turkey and Uzbekistan as member countries, and Hungary as an observer state.
